R8 Spyder 4.2 V8

Audi adds a V8 option for drop-top R8 Spyder.

The R8 Spyder now has two fewer cylinders! The German firm has slotted its 4.2-litre V8 unit into the stunning drop-top.

The 424bhp unit joins the 518bhp V10, completing the two-strong Spyder range. A six-speed manual gearbox is standard, but many buyers are expected to opt for the six-speed R Tronic automated manual. Quattro four-wheel drive remains standard.

Despite its lower cylinder count, performance remains seriously impressive. Regardless of transmission, the 0-62mph sprint takes just 4.8sec and top speed is 185mph. With R Tronic, fuel consumption is 20.3mpg, falling to 19mpg with the manual box.

Aside from the engine change, the same high level of standard kit, aluminium spaceframe body and retractable folding cloth roof. The UK on sale date and price are still to be confirmed.
